WW2 era stamped helmet shells were manufactured differently than post-war made shells. the placement of the rim seam will almost always accurately determine when the shell was produced, besiding a few examples that exist. Almost all WW2 era made shells have the rim seam in the front. Hence, a front seam helmet.
